1. There Are More Possible Games of Chess Than Atoms in the Universe

The number of possible chess games is called Shannon’s Number — about
10¹²⁰ different combinations.

That’s more than the estimated number of atoms in the observable universe.

2. Wombat Poop Is Cube-Shaped

Yes, cube-shaped.

Wombats produce square droppings, which scientists believe helps prevent them from rolling away and marks territory more effectively.

3. Your Brain Uses About 20% of Your Body’s Energy

Despite weighing only about 2% of your body, the brain consumes around 20% of your total energy.

4. There Are “Immortal” Jellyfish

A species called Turritopsis dohrnii can reverse its life cycle and return to its juvenile form after reaching adulthood.

5. You Can Smell Rain Before It Falls

That fresh, earthy smell before rain is called petrichor.
It comes from plant oils and bacteria released into the air when rain approaches.

6. Humans Glow in the Dark (Very Faintly)

Chemical reactions inside the human body produce a tiny amount of visible light.

7. A Day on Venus Is Longer Than a Year on Venus

Venus rotates so slowly that one full day takes longer than one full orbit around the sun.
